What this video covers

Troubleshooting a Victron battery monitor requires verifying the shunt installation and programming parameters to ensure accurate state-of-charge readings. The shunt must be wired so that only the battery bank connects to the battery side, while all loads, chargers, and chassis grounds connect to the system side.▶ 1:19 If the shunt is installed in reverse, the Victron Connect app allows users to toggle the current measurement direction to "reverse" without rewiring.▶ 3:51 Programming errors often stem from an incorrectly set charged voltage; the rule of thumb for a 12-volt system is to set the charged voltage 0.2 volts below the charger's absorption voltage.▶ 6:12 When the monitor displays a double-dash symbol after a power reset, it indicates the device lacks a confident state-of-charge reading.▶ 7:00 Users can configure the "battery state of charge on reset" setting to "clear" or "keep state of charge," though "clear" is preferred to avoid inaccurate guesses after long periods of inactivity.▶ 7:14 Charging the battery bank to the full absorption voltage via shore power will reset the monitor to 100%.▶ 10:55
